One of the most popular file formats today is MP4 (MPEG-4 Part 14). Introduced in 2001, MP4 revolutionized video sharing and streaming. This format allowed for efficient compression and playback of video content, making it an ideal choice for online video platforms.

Another widely used file format is JPG (Joint Photographic Experts Group). Introduced in 1992, JPG became the de facto standard for image compression. The format uses a lossy compression algorithm, which discards some of the image data to reduce the file size.
